Job Description – Senior HR Advisor (Residential in Equatorial Guinea)

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:
  • Act as a true partner to deliver business impact through the full employee lifecycle by building, developing, and retaining a high performing and diverse workforce.
  • This role will partner with the leaders of The Company and where required provide support to the HR Manager.
  • This role will lead key HR projects such as workforce planning and talent management.
  • Lives the Company Values and applies them in day-to-day work.
  • Adopt a Business Partner approach by building strong working relationships and building credibility, through regular communications with senior business leaders to understand and meet on-going/future business requirements, ensuring that HR play a part in the successful achievement of business objectives.
  • Provide professional and proactive HR advice and guidance within defined business areas within Asset Solutions business unit in line with Company standards and processes. Work in full partnership with leaders and managers to provide guidance and advice on all HR matters, ensuring that at all times Employment Law is adhered to.
  • Develop, maintain and update HR Policies and procedures, compile standard operating practices identifying important policy issues for organisation development taking into consideration current applicable local and international laws, company requirements and future trends.
  • Responsibility for the end-to-end employee lifecycle including, but not limited to, Recruitment, Reward, Performance Management, Talent Management and Succession Planning, Retention, Employee Relations, business planning and forecasting, working in collaboration with the Learning & Development team, where applicable.
  • Support the development of the Client’s National Content Programme, working in collaboration with the Learning and Development team.
  • Coach, advise and support senior business leaders so that they manage their people effectively and maximise their teams’ performance.
  • Investigate employee motivation and job satisfaction concerns, implement effective employee motivation strategies.
  • Take the lead on resolving complex employee relations issues ensuring that Petrofac values and standards are always maintained.
  • Work with colleagues in specialist areas to develop Reward and Benefit packages and ensure effective communication in the defined business area.
  • Respond to employee-related queries and provide answers to all HR-related inquiries and requests.
  • Create statistical reports concerning employee-related data to the local leadership team, highlighting trends.
  • Attend weekly business partner meetings with senior leaders, presenting meaningful HR Metrics and present action-based solutions to issues.
